Feasibility Studies
Grayling Education Surveys have partnered with schools for over 10 years, conducting Feasibility Studies to explore potential site developments. These studies provide detailed costings and options, creating a “shopping list” for schools to consider. The feasibility often contributes to a phased masterplan, allowing Business Managers and Headteachers to strategically assess projects and their impact. Our experienced Architects and Surveyors offer phasing strategies that minimise disruption, ensuring construction work on live school sites does not affect pupils’ performance or staff operations.
Planning Applications
Grayling Thomas Architects are experts in securing planning approvals for schools, handling both Outline and Detailed Planning Applications. We understand planning legislation and offer early advice on expected outcomes. We also submit Planning Pre-Applications and provide support through Grayling Education Surveys with services like Measured Surveys and Premises Assessments. We manage complex site issues (e.g., Archaeology, Ecology, Flooding) by involving specialists and handle the entire planning process, including discharging conditions, to assist Business Managers, Bursars, and Headteachers efficiently.

Principal Designer + CDM
Under the CDM 2015 Regulations, construction projects must be reported to the Health and Safety Executive if they last over 30 working days with 20+ workers on-site or exceed 500 person-days. Clients must appoint a Principal Designer, a role we provide to schools and clients. As Principal Designers, we manage health and safety throughout the pre-construction phase, performing risk assessments and designing out risks early on. We assist clients with pre-construction information, guide contractor appointments, and coordinate with all designers to mitigate risks. We also liaise with the Principal Contractor to ensure ongoing risk management during construction.
